Product is supplied at 1 mL (100 µL/mL). This antibody recognizes the spacer domain and reacts with molecular species of 55 kDa or a doublet of 55 kDa and 60 kDa (glycosylated form). Note that proteolysis of Punctin-1 has been described and additional smaller bands may also be obtained.
Western blotting applications the antibody works better in non-reducing than reducing conditions although it will also recognize the reduced antigen at correspondingly higher concentrations.
Punctin (ADAMTSL-1) is a secreted molecule, expressed in adult skeletal muscle, resembling members of the ADAMTS family of proteases, containing four thrombospondin type I repeats. Human punctin cleaves aggrecan and is thereby classified as an aggrecanase. Like the ADAMTS proteases, each domain in punctin has an even number of cysteine residues suggesting that each domain may have internal disulfide bonds and that punctin consists of a series of independently folded and disulfide-bonded domains.
